Circular hike on little frequented paths with beautiful viewpoints and a wonderful picnic spot by an idyllically located pond.

The beautiful spa town Gohrisch is a popular holiday destination in the Elbe Sandstone Mountains south of the Elbe and an ideal starting point for this not too difficult circular hike. The hiking trail is mostly well passable, and there is basically only one more challenging descent each as well as a short climb immediately after. The path to the Liliensteinblick viewpoint is partially interspersed with roots, but the short detour at the beginning of the route is definitely worth it. Additionally, very close by is also the Lapidarium and Arboretum, which is located in a fenced area for protection from wildlife browsing and accessible via two self-closing gates. The picnic spot at Hörnelteich is well suited for an extended rest. By the way, this can also be easily reached on a short path from Gohrisch (this route in reverse), which is why the excursion there is especially recommended for e-wheelchair users.
